  • WEEKEND RIDE IN JARRAHDALE ANYONE????

    October 22nd, 2009

    We have been getting some queries about when we are having our next ride, so I thought I would make a suggestion and see if anyone is interested.  I am happy to host a weekend ride in Jarrahdale, with overnight camp here at my place, to make it easier for me!!! No extra organisation for camping somewhere.
    Saturday would be a meet in Jarrahdale at the Jarrahdale Oval at about 12.30 pm and ride to Tony Gyles for a quick visit then over to the Railway line and down to the South West Highway Mundijong for a quick afternoon tea, and then back up the hill to the floats following the old railway line back again.  This would be suitable for carts.  Distance would be approx 20 – 25  km.
    We would then float back to my place and camp with possibly a hot spa on offer at the end….. at least a hot shower anyway.
    Next day we would pack up camp and float over to the Cnr of Rails Court and South West Highway in South Armadale, arriving there about 9.30 am – 10.00 am and then ride along the Wungong Valley and up to the top of the Byford Hills, for those wanting a shorter ride that day, they could ride to the Wungong Dam and back again.  This unfortunately is not suitable for carts as CALM won’t give permission for them to ride in this area and it is all gated off.  If there are carts who do want to come for the weekend I could arrange a separate ride in the Darling Downs area which is very suitable for carts and easy to follow on a map.  Distance on Sunday will depend on how much people want to do.
    Both of these rides can be shortened if the weather is very warm and ridden in the evening or early morning if necessary, as applicable.
    It would be BYO everything, but there will be plenty of human and horse water, of course, at my place as well as all the modern conveniences.
    So, please let me know if you are interested and if I get enough people to make it an event, which will only take a couple. I will give proper ride details later.

    Riding with other ATHRA Affiliated Clubs

    September 30th, 2009

    This is just to let you all know that as ATHRA members we can join in other club’s events who are affiliated without having to pay for insurance again, as we are already covered.  The clubs currently affiliated in WA are:

    W A Horse Trekkers Club

    Albany Natural Trail Riders

    Coolgardie Pleasure Riding Club

    Esperance Riders Club

    Boddington Riding Club – Yes it’s official they have joined!!!!

    Currently I send to all WAHTC members the Albany Natural Trail Riders Newsletter when it is sent to me, which keeps us up to date on what they are up to and I am sure they would love for some of us to join in with what they are doing. Their latest newsletter is attached which has their up and coming ride details in it.

    Boddington Riding Club have already invited us to join them on a ride in Quindanning along part of the same trail that will be used for the Boddington Endurance Ride they are hosting at the end of October, which they have also invited us to as this is a fundraiser for their club.  The ride along part of the Endurance trail is to be held on Sunday, 11th October starting at about 8.30am and Angela Davies has offered her place as somewhere to stay the Saturday night since it is an early start.  Angela can be contacted by email on angela.davies@westnet.com.au or by phone on 08 9885 7178.  This ride will be a Boddington Riding Club Ride.  Those with carts will need to check with Angela if this ride is suitable.

    They would also love for us to come along to the Social 25 km ride which is part of the Boddington Endurance Ride details of which are below.

    Boddington Endurance Ride

    Boddington Riding Club is hosting it’s inaugural endurance ride on Saturday 31st October. This new ride has everything the serious endurance rider and the recreational social rider are looking for. Varied terrain of natural bush and farmland offers spectacular views across the valleys in this beautiful rolling landscape one hour south of Armadale.  There is a stimulating 80 km official course for the serious competitor’s, and a shorter 40 km training ride for those with young or new horses.  Social riders who want to enjoy a 25 km leisurely ramble through lovely countryside are encouraged to come along and meet the friendly folk at Boddington.  Great camping facilities are available.  W.A. Endurance Riders Assn. endorses the ride which will be conducted under their rules and the 40 km and 25 km rides are open to non members of the Association.  Details of the ride are on the website www.waera.asn.au or from Melissa Taylor 9883 9108 or 0428 988 391.

    Now we have more clubs joining ATHRA this is a great opportunity for us to meet more people, see more of this great country of ours and just get out and enjoy some more riding.

    Murchison Trek – Change of Dates

    June 8th, 2009

    The changing of dates for the Murchison Trek has been finalised and is now confirmed.

    The Trek will now be held from 31st August – 11 Sept 2009. Non-refundable Deposits for the trek need to be paid by 17th July 2009 and final payment is due no later than 14th August 2009

    We should have a newsletter out shortly detailing some weekend rides we are planning to hold over the next couple of months which we would strongly recommend new members and new horses intending to go on the trek make every effort to attend. It is club policy that any one wanting to attend our annual two week trek must attend at least two rides with the horse they intend using before attempting the whole two weeks. We would appreciate members complying to this policy as it is in the interest of your own safety, the safety of your horse and all other riders and horses on the trek! This years trek is again in a very remote area of our great state and when an incident occurs to either horse or rider it can have some very dire consequences!!!!

    Denmark Deposit and Membership 2009 DUE!!!!

    January 30th, 2009

    Hello Trekkers,

    This is just a quick reminder that deposits of $100 for the Denmark Trek were due on 28th January 2009. So far we have 13 participants and 9 horses. If you would still like to come, we will be accepting deposits until 4th February, but there will not be any late entries or payments accepted after this date. If you need a form they are available under forms link above. Final payment for the trek will be due on 28th February.

    Membership Forms and Fees for 2009 are also now due. At our AGM last weekend it was decided to leave the membership fee the same this year, which is $60.00. If you are a new member you will need to pay a $20.00 joining fee also. To be able to participate for more than two days on any trek, including Denmark, participants will have to be members, so membership needs to be paid along with the Denmark deposit to be eligible as a participant.

    Any new members wanting to participate on the Denmark trek are requested to attend the Long Weekend ride in March (February 28, March 1-2), 2009 in Bridgetown as an introduction to trekking and to make sure both horse and rider are up to riding 192kms in 7 days with no rest days.
